B.Tech in Computer Science: Course, Eligibility, Syllabus, Admission Process

Vignan Institute of Technology and Science > Blog > Blog > B.Tech in Computer Science: Course, Eligibility, Syllabus, Admission Process
B.tech in Computer Science

B.Tech in Computer Science is a course that deals with computers and computer applications, the essential elements of our daily life today. Students of this stream learn to study, analyze, evaluate and prepare designs to solve problems.

They also prepare programs to assist organizations with regard to their day-to-day operations. They innovate to change the digital arena for good.

The stream combines theoretical and practical learning that every student has to undergo during the course. Computer Science colleges in Hyderabad are there plenty. Thus getting admission to any of the top B.Tech colleges in Hyderabad is a breeze.

Here is a general overview of the course:

CourseB.Tech in Computer Science
Duration4 years
Type of ExaminationSemesters
Eligibility10+2 (with physics, chemistry, and mathematics with minimum 50% marks)
Admission ProcessEntrance examination
Average Annual SalaryINR 1000000
Top Employers:IT firms across the globe
Jobs availableWebsite developer, software-hardware developer, database administrator

Eligibility Requirements

  • A student enrolling for B.Tech should have passed Class 12 or any other equivalent examination from a recognized board with a minimum of 45% marks.
  • If the applicant has taken Physics, Chemistry, and Mathematics as compulsory subjects during higher secondary will work in favour.

Also Read: 5 Programming languages that every Techie Should Master

Syllabus

The following is a standardized syllabus that many top B.Tech colleges in Hyderabad follow:

SemesterTheoryPractical
Semester 1Programming for Problem-Solving, Calculus and Abstract Algebra Engineering Physics-I, Environmental Studies, Human Value & EthicsCommunicative English-1, Programming for Problem Solving Lab, Introduction to Computer Science and Engineering, Computer-Aided Design & Drafting, Mechanical Workshop and Physics Lab
Semester 2Application-based Programming in Python, Probability, and Statistics, Principles of Electrical and Electronics Engineering, Human Value & Ethics, Environmental StudiesCommunicative English -2, Design and creativity Lab, Application-based Programming in Python, Mechanical Workshop, Computer-Aided Design & Drafting, Principles of Electrical and Electronics Engineering
Semester 3Data Structures, Discrete Structures, Computer Organization, and Architecture, Object-Oriented Programming Using Java, Principles of Operating Systems, Introduction of EntrepreneurshipAptitude Reasoning and Business Communication Skills – Basic, Data Structures Lab, Principles of Operating System Lab, Object-Oriented Programming Using Java, Project-Based Learning (PBL) -1, Summer Internship-I
Semester 4Introduction to Biology for Engineers, Data Base Management System, Theory of Computation, Computer Networks, Program Elective-1, Mathematical Techniques, Introduction to Graph Theory and its ApplicationsAptitude Reasoning and Business Communication Skills- Intermediate, Data Base Management System Lab, Computer Networks Lab, Project-Based Learning (PBL) -2
Semester 5Design and Analysis of Algorithm, Software Engineering and Testing Methodologies, Research Methodology, Introduction to Cloud Computing, Android Application Development, Web TechnologiesQuantitative Aptitude Behavioral and Interpersonal Skills, Design and Analysis of Algorithm Lab, Project-Based Learning (PBL) -3, Software Engineering and Testing Methodologies, Summer Internship-II, Technical Skill Enhancement Course-1 Simulation Lab
Semester 6Compiler Design, Management for Engineers, Digital Image Processing, Software Project Management, Software Testing, Wireless Networks, Risk Management, Advanced Operating SystemHigher-Order Mathematics and Advanced People Skills, Compiler Design Lab, Technical Skill Enhancement Course-2 (Application Development Lab), Project-Based Learning (PBL) -4
Semester 7Artificial Intelligence, Mobile Computing, Quantum Computing, Introduction to the Internet of Things, Parallel Computing Algorithms, 3D Printing and Software Tools,Artificial Intelligence Lab, Summer Internship-III
Semester 8Project & Viva-voce 

Process of Admission

Like any other technical course, B.Tech in Computer Science requires that you pass the entrance test your choice college conducts. Certain colleges provide an inquiry form that you have to fill up. And the institute will respond to it on time.

Do your research, review your choice college’s affiliations and get admission into any of the top B.Tech colleges in Hyderabad.

Leave a Reply